Astra Credit Companies' Non-Performing Loans are Below the Multifinance Industry Average

KONTAN.CO.ID - JAKARTA. PT Astra Sedaya Finance, also known as Astra Credit Companies (ACC), recorded a Non-Performing Financing (NPF) rate below the multifinance industry average.

Previously, the Financial Services Authority (OJK) recorded the financing company's gross NPF at 2.72% as of January 2026.

Riadi Prasodjo, EVP of Corporate Communication & Strategy at ACC, stated that ACC's NPF remained stable and maintained below 1% as of January 2026.

"This is supported by the implementation of risk management and governance practices in accordance with applicable regulations," he told Kontan on Friday (March 6, 2026).

ACC also spoke about financing prospects during Ramadan and Eid al-Fitr. Riadi stated that the Ramadan-Eid al-Fitr period is generally accompanied by increased public demand, potentially driving financing activity.

However, he stated that ACC is still monitoring the impact of this activity on the company's performance, in line with the dynamics of existing market conditions.

This year, Riadi stated that several factors could influence the NPF figure, including the dynamics of economic conditions, developments in public purchasing power, and changes in customer risk profiles.

To maintain a manageable NPF figure, Riadi explained that ACC will undertake several efforts. He stated that the company remains committed to implementing risk management and governance practices in accordance with applicable regulations.

Riadi added that the assessment process for prospective borrowers is also conducted based on the principles of character, capacity, capital, collateral, and condition (5Cs) to ensure the financing process is carried out in a measured manner and maintains healthy financing quality.
